Urine Microscopic Image Dataset

19 Nov 2021  ·  Dipam Goswami, Hari Om Aggrawal, Rajiv Gupta, Vinti Agarwal ·

Urinalysis is a standard diagnostic test to detect urinary system related problems. The automation of urinalysis will reduce the overall diagnostic time. Recent studies used urine microscopic datasets for designing deep learning based algorithms to classify and detect urine cells. But these datasets are not publicly available for further research. To alleviate the need for urine datsets, we prepare our urine sediment microscopic image (UMID) dataset comprising of around 3700 cell annotations and 3 categories of cells namely RBC, pus and epithelial cells. We discuss the several challenges involved in preparing the dataset and the annotations. We make the dataset publicly available.
